Award BIOS Setup Utility
Clock By Slight Adjust
This field provides several options for selecting the external system
bus clock of the processor. The available options allow you to adjust
the processor' s bus clock by 1MHz increment.
If you selected an option other than the default setting and is unable
to boot up the system, there are 2 methods of booting up the
system and going back to its default setting.
Method 1:
Clear the CMOS data by setting JP9 to 2-3 On. All fields in the
BIOS Setup will automatically be set to their default settings.
Method 2:
Press the <Insert> key and power button simultaneously, then
release the power button first. Keep-on pressing the <Insert> key
until the power-on screen appears. This will allow the system to boot
according to the FSB of the processor. Now press the <Del> key
to enter the main menu of the BIOS. Select "Frequency/Voltage
Control" and set the "Clock By Slight Adjust" field to its default
setting or an appropriate bus clock.

Important:
Overclocking may result to the processor's or system's
instability and are not guaranteed to provide better system
performance.
Note:
Use a PS/2 or AT (requires a DIN to mini DIN adapter)
keyboard for method 2.
